I’ve tried a ton of different foundations and concealers throughout the years and I’ve discovered that it’s not always the formula that needs a change. Sometimes it’s our approach, skin and technique that needs a little tweaking. Foundation and concealer has a tendency to emphasize dry skin putting the spotlight on flaky patches and fine lines rather than creating that smooth, flawless finish we crave. Now, there’s plenty of moisturizing foundations and concealers out there but if you’re anything like me you’ll quickly learn that they’re not without flaws either. Some moisturizing formulas tend to settle into fine lines and wrinkles as well as fade quickly, look greasy or just feel too rich–especially in the summer. That’s why I like to focus on correcting my dry skin with a solid skincare routine (which I’ll soon share!) and a good hydrating formula to ensure that my makeup applies and wears beautifully all day.

5 Primers for Dry Skin: Urban Decay Brightening & Tightening Complexion Primer Potion

Urban Decay Brightening & Tightening Complexion Primer Potion ($31.00)

I’ve been a fan of Urban Decay’s Original Eyeshadow Primer Potion for years so when the Complexion Primer Potions went on sale for half off at Ulta on Black Friday I knew I had to grab one. Urban Decay has 2 Complexion Primer Potions but after trying them in the store the Brightening & Tightening Complexion Primer Potion was the clear winner for me. It’s formulated to moisturize dry, dull skin and lift and firm skin over time while adding a radiant glow that makes applying foundation a breeze. The Urban Decay Brightening & Tightening Complexion Primer Potion has a lightweight gel texture with a slight cooling effect that soothes my dry skin while adding a burst of moisture and giving my skin a luminous glow and smoother appearance. It quickly became one of my holy grail primers as the formula helps my foundation apply smoothly and last all day without looking cakey or settling into my fine lines. The Urban Decay Brightening & Tightening Complexion is a wonderful option for dry, dull skin that suffers from flaky patches, fine lines and sensitive skin.

5 Primers for Dry Skin: NYX Honey Dew Me Up Primer Serum

NYX Honey Dew Me Up Serum & Primer ($16.99)

Besides fine lines, one of the biggest struggles with dry skin is dullness. Dry skin has a tendency to look dull and lackluster some days that makes makeup look flat and dry. The easiest way to fight dullness is with a good luminous primer that helps boost radiance to bring life back to skin with a dewy glow. When my skin starts to look flat and dull, I reach for the NYX Honey Dew Me Up Serum & Primer. It has a gel-like texture that mimics the feel of honey and a slight stickiness upon application that absorbs quickly to lightly moisturize and give skin a killer radiant glow. NYX Honey Dew Me Up Serum & Primer really helps to prime dull skin for a smoother, luminous finish that lasts all day without looking cakey and flat by the end of the day. As the name applies, Honey Dew Me Up also serves as a serum formulated with honey and collagen to hydrate and plump skin while neutralizing the appearance of discoloration and redness over time. I’ve been using the NYX Honey Dew Me Up Serum & Primer for about a year now because it does such a good job at making my dry, dull skin glow like no tomorrow without looking greasy, glittery or oily. I think the NYX Honey Dew Me Up Serum & Primer would make a wonderful addition to your stash if you struggle with a dull, lackluster complexion.

5 Primers for Dry Skin: Milani Prime Perfection Hydrating + Pore-Minimizing Face Primer

Milani Prime Perfection Hydrating + Pore Minimizing Face Primer ($9.99)

Drugstore makeup is overflowing with lipsticks, foundations, eyeshadows and more but you’d be hard pressed to find a decent primer in the mix. Milani recently added 2 new primers to their collection including the Prime Perfection Hydrating + Pore Minimizing Face Primer. I picked it up hoping that it would be a good dupe for the Urban Decay Brightening & Tightening Complexion Primer Potion but it’s a completely different formula. The Milani Prime Perfection Hydrating + Pore Minimizing Primer adds a touch of moisture while providing a smooth luminous base that helps makeup adhere better to skin. It has a lightweight creamy texture that goes on smoothly  and lightly hydrates skin while adding a soft radiance and helping my makeup last a little bit longer throughout the day without much settling or looking cakey. The Prime Perfection Hydrating + Pore Minimizing Primer isn’t quite as hydrating as I was expecting but I do think it’ll be a great formula for summer. The formula isn’t quite as rich as a more hydrating primer so it won’t make your skin look too dewy or oily as you sweat and it also has a slightly sticky feel that really grabs on to foundation so that it adheres and lasts a little longer. The Milani Prime Perfection Hydrating + Pore Minimizing definitely won’t replace your moisturizer but it’s a good option for dry skin in the summer.

5 Primers for Dry Skin: Laura Geller Spackle Bronze Tinted Under Make-Up Primer

Laura Geller Tinted Under Make-Up Primer in Bronze ($32.00)

Tinted primers usually don’t fly with my brown skin because they’re typically too light and too pigmented for my taste but Laura Geller got it just right with her Tinted Under Make-Up Primer in Bronze. At first, I was just interested in seeing what the bronze tint would be like but when I tried it out at Ulta I discovered just how moisturizing and dewy Laura Geller’s Tinted Under Make-Up Primer was. It has a lightweight gel texture that’s very soothing and hydrating as well as a sheer bronze tint that adds a subtle warmth and dewy glow to my complexion without looking glittery or too shiny. I love to reach for the Laura Geller Tinted Under Make-Up Primer in Bronze when my skin is feeling a little dry and dull and could use a quick moisture and radiance boost. It’s the perfect primer for dry, dull skin that looks sallow or could just use a little warmth and glow.

5 Primers for Dry Skin: Too Faced Hangover Replenishing Face Primer

Too Faced Hangover Replenishing Face Primer ($32.00)

Most makeup primers just provide short term benefits when it comes to dry skin. Like temporarily moisturizing skin instead of deeply hydrating and treating skin from within. Too Faced took a completely different approach with their Hangover Replenishing Face Primer and I couldn’t love them more for it. Too Faced’s Hangover Replenishing Face Primer has been a staple in my routine for years because it doesn’t just prime dry skin for a smooth, flawless finish but it also helps to treat skin with skin-loving ingredients like coconut water and probiotics. Hangover Replenishing Face Primer is like a splash of water for dry skin adding lots of moisture, a radiant glow and a smoother appearance with lightweight lotion-like texture that can be used alone as a moisturizer. That’s how hydrating it is! I think severe dry skin or even gals with oily skin who needs a lightweight moisturizer would find the Too Faced Hangover Replenishing Primer to be a real treat.
